Gingerbread French Toast Casserole

This festive Gingerbread French Toast Casserole is soft on the inside and crispy on the outside. Filled with cozy gingerbread spices, this baked French toast is the best holiday breakfast on Christmas, or any cold winter morning. Gluten-Free & Vegan.

Ingredients

  • 1 loaf Gluten-Free Bread cubed into 1 inch pieces
  • 2 cups Plant-Based Milk unsweetened
  • 2 tablespoon Flax Seeds ground
  • 2 tablespoon Tapioca Flour cornstarch also works well.
  • ½ cup Molasses
  • ½ cup Brown Sugar
  • 1 teaspoon Pure Vanilla Extract
  • 1 teaspoon Ginger
  • teaspoon Cinnamon
  • ½ teaspoon All-Spice
  • ½ teaspoon Nutmeg
  • ¼ teaspoon Cloves
  • ¼ teaspoon Salt

Optional

  • 1 cup Fresh Cranberries

Instructions

  • Preheat oven to 350 F. Grease a 9x13 inch baking pan.
  • In a large bowl, whisk together milk, molasses, sugar, cinnamon, ginger, all spice, cloves, nutmeg, vanilla extract. and salt. Add flax seeds and tapioca flour then whisk until there are no lumps. Let the mixture sit for a few minutes until it thickens.
  • Place cubed bread in a large mixing bowl, then pour milk mixture on top. Stir to combine, and let sit for 30 minutes (or up to overnight), tossing halfway through until bread is coated on all sides. Mix in fresh cranberries if using.
  • Cover with foil and bake for 20 minutes. Remove foil then continue to cook for 20 more minutes. Serve warm dusted with powdered sugar and/or a drizzle of maple syrup on top.

Notes

How to store: Cover or store in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 2 days.
How to reheat: Reheat in the microwave 30 second intervals until warmed through, or in a 350F preheated oven for 10-15 minutes.
